Attacks & Strategy

  • Amnesia [Colorless]
    Choose 1 of the Defending Pokémon's attacks. That Pokémon can't use that attack during your opponent's next turn.
  • Scavenge [Colorless]
    Search your discard pile for a Trainer card, show it to your opponent, and put it into your hand.
